Lead People/Agency: Governor Ralph Northam and Virginia ABC Chief Executive Officer Travis Hill

Overview: Governor Ralph Northam today issued an executive directive authorizing the Virginia Alcoholic Beverage Control Authority (ABC) to defer annual fees for licenses and permits that would be up for renewal through June. The Governor also directed the Virginia ABC to allow establishments with mixed beverage licenses, such as restaurants and distilleries, to sell mixed beverages through takeout or delivery, effective at midnight Thursday.

United States 04/08/2020 Specific Action Health 8; 8.3; 9; 9.1; 11; 11.4 Legal and policy; New initiatives; Planning and strategy; Creation of or release of plans; Finance policy and financial aid; Financial aid to health services https://gov.texas.gov/news/post/governor-abbott-announces-texas-military-department-prestige-ameritech-partnership-to-increase-mask-production Governor Greg Abbott held a press conference where he provided an update on the production and distribution of personal protective equipment (PPE) in Texas. The Governor announced a new partnership between the Texas Military Department (TMD) and Prestige Ameritech to increase the production of face masks for health care workers. Prestige Ameritech’s 24-hour operation at their headquarters near Fort Worth will be staffed in part by members of the Texas National Guard 36th Infantry Division and will produce 2 million masks per week. For example, on March 24, the Governor announced that the Texas Division of Emergency Management (TDEM) will begin receiving 100,000 masks per day by the end of that week and the Supply Chain Strike Force will begin receiving an additional 100,000 masks per day by the end of next week—meaning the State of Texas will soon be receiving more than one million masks per week. On April 6, the Governor also announced that Texas received 2.5 million masks in the past 24 hours, and will receive an additional 3 million masks by April 11th.
